OVERVIEW FREE VERSION
Change payment desciption is an easy and simple way to change payment parameter “Blog Name” for your site/shop. It removes the need to add custom snippets to your theme’s functions.php file.
Change payment desciption is essentially a mini-plugin with less load on your site. Change payment desciption changes that by providing a GUI interface on the WooCommerce setting page for adding text and actually running them on your site just as if they were in your theme’s functions.php file.
We frist provide to change the payment desciption for the Payment Plugin WooCommerce Stripe Payment Gateway.

- Upload plugin files to your plugins folder, or install the plugin through the WordPress plugins screen directly;
- Activate the plugin through the ‘Plugins’ screen in WordPress;
- Go to the Settingspage “WooCommerce->Settings->Change Payment Description” screen to configure the plugin.
